“State of emergency is a suitable precaution”


21.07.2016 / Ankara



In a statement regarding the President of the Republic of Turkey, Recep Tayyip Erdoğan’s announcement of the state of emergency declaration of the National Security Council, TOBB President M. Rifat Hisarcıklıoğlu said, “We are going through extraordinary days and what will bring us to safe harbor is determination. We see this determination in our government and we have full confidence in the fact that we will soon become a more peaceful and secure country.”​

Hisarcıklıoğlu said in his statement:

“The state of emergency, like in any civilized country, has been put in effect in order to ensure that civil and free life can resume with the shortest interval while the putschists who targeted the lives, property and government of the people can be brought before the law and to prevent further uprisings.

Our government and nation has overcome a great trial. The heinous coup attempt has been thwarted. Everyone should recognize the gravity of the situation. These are extraordinary circumstances and extraordinary measures are called for. In recent months a terror attack took place in France and a state of emergency was declared in order to take precautions. Yesterday, that state of emergency was extended for another 6 months.

The government must take precautions against threats to itself. To this end, declaring a state of emergency is a suitable precaution. The preserve public peace and ensure continuation of services necessitated this decision.

What’s important here is that democracy and freedoms are protected and the regular functioning of the economy. In this regard, the President of the Republic of Turkey, Recep Tayyip Erdoğan as well as other relevant authorities have given the necessary explanations. It is our duty as a nation to assist our government in these difficult times.”
